引言

在计算机科学的学习过程中,实验环节是不可或缺的一部分。它不仅能够帮助我们巩固理论知识,还能够提升我们的实践能力。作为一名计算机专业的学生,我在多次实验中积累了一些心得体会,希望与大家分享,帮助大家更好地应对实验挑战。

一、实验前的准备工作

  1. 明确实验目的:在开始实验之前,首先要明确实验的目的和意义,这对于后续的实验过程至关重要。

  2. 查阅相关资料:通过查阅教材、网络资源等途径,了解实验所需的理论知识和操作步骤。

  3. 熟悉实验环境:在实验前,熟悉实验所使用的软件、硬件环境,避免实验过程中出现不必要的麻烦。

  4. 制定实验计划:根据实验目的和时间安排,制定详细的实验计划,确保实验过程有条不紊。

二、实验过程中的注意事项

  1. 细心操作:在实验过程中,要严格按照实验步骤进行操作,避免因操作失误导致实验失败。

  2. 及时记录:在实验过程中,及时记录实验数据、观察到的现象等,为后续分析提供依据。

  3. 发现问题:在实验过程中,要善于发现问题、分析问题,并尝试寻找解决方案。

  4. 团队合作:在实验过程中,与团队成员保持良好的沟通,共同完成实验任务。

三、实验后的总结与反思

  1. 分析实验结果:对实验结果进行分析,验证实验目的是否达到,找出实验过程中存在的问题。

  2. 总结实验经验:总结实验过程中的成功经验和教训,为今后的实验提供借鉴。

  3. 撰写实验报告:按照实验报告的要求,认真撰写实验报告,包括实验目的、实验步骤、实验结果、实验分析等。

  4. 分享经验:将自己在实验过程中的心得体会与同学们分享,共同提高。

四、案例分析

以下是一个简单的实验案例,以帮助大家更好地理解实验过程。

实验目的

通过编写一个简单的计算器程序,掌握基本的编程技巧,并熟悉编程环境。

实验步骤

  1. 打开编程环境(如Visual Studio Code)。

  2. 创建一个新的Python文件,命名为“calculator.py”。

  3. 编写计算器程序代码,如下所示:

def add(x, y):
    return x + y

def subtract(x, y):
    return x - y

def multiply(x, y):
    return x * y

def divide(x, y):
    if y == 0:
        return "Error! Division by zero."
    else:
        return x / y

# 测试程序
num1 = float(input("Enter first number: "))
num2 = float(input("Enter second number: "))

print("Select operation:")
print("1. Add")
print("2. Subtract")
print("3. Multiply")
print("4. Divide")

choice = input("Enter choice(1/2/3/4): ")

if choice == '1':
    print("Result:", add(num1, num2))
elif choice == '2':
    print("Result:", subtract(num1, num2))
elif choice == '3':
    print("Result:", multiply(num1, num2))
elif choice == '4':
    print("Result:", divide(num1, num2))
else:
    print("Invalid Input")
  1. 运行程序,进行测试。

  2. 分析实验结果,总结经验。

五、结语

通过以上总结,相信大家对如何掌握计算机基础、应对实验挑战有了更深入的了解。在今后的学习过程中,希望大家能够注重实验环节,不断提升自己的实践能力。祝大家在实验中取得优异成绩!